I realize this thread itself is old, but I have some good news - AdventureX is happening this December! I've had to downsize the event a little bit - it won't be held in London now but rather a town outside of London (Didcot). It's 100m from the station. Didcot can be reached within 45 mins on train from London, and also easily using the motorways M40 and M4.

All of the guests for this first, humble event will all be UK based adventure game developers, as it won't be possible to fund overseas speakers this time round. Currently attending and giving a presentation is Mr Bateman, one of the chaps behind Discworld Noir. I'm also trying to get some of the people I previously asked to turn up, and there will be many people from the AGS scene as well. Hope to also have some tutorials and debates.

It will still be a 2 day event, on a Saturday and Sunday, either 10th & 11th of Dec or 17th and 18th Dec. Something fun to do around the Christmas season.

There will of course be many point & clicks to take a look at, especially ones being made by indie developers. I will try and get some previews from commercial companies where possible. It's a chance to turn up, meet like minded fans and developers. There will be space for you to chill with your laptop and work on your own games if you feel motivated enough.
